The ship docked at Astoria, OR at 9 AM. As soon as everything was cleared we disembarked. Immediately awaiting us were vendors selling crafts, souvenirs, wine, etc. We bought a hand carved alder wood vase. The bus into Astoria was $5 for an all day pass. We had toured the historic town before, but we did the Maritime Museum again. After heavy cold fog in the morning it turned into a beautiful clear day. The white clouds made a beautiful backdrop for the Columbia River in photographs! We hope We captured some good ones! We took the trolley up to the Astoria Column where the view of the Columbia River and countryside was spectacular. The column is covered with murals depicting Northwestern  history from 1792 to the 1880's. 
We arrived back on the ship after 2:00 and ate lunch. Leah took some more pictures from the 12th level of the ship of the river and the port. Then followed a little rest. We attended a very good show with the singer, Jack Walker. That was followed by the usual 5 course dinner.
